Famat is ISO 14001 certified since May 2002. This environment management system is dedicated to the preservation of the environment.

A continuous improvement tool is also used to assess the performance of EHS management.


Our environmental policy is active through the following means and actions as well:


  1.     Quality monitoring of liquid water wastes at effluent recycling station — operational since 1989 (5874 m3 on 2009)

  2.     Save raw materials

  3.     Select our wastes where they are produced — operational since 1993 (122T of wastes sold on 2009)

  4.     Select and resale the different kinds of metals used by FAMAT. (324T on 2009)

Famat is a jointly-owned production facility of Snecma and General Electric, two major engine manufacturers.



Famat produces major structural parts for the CF6, CFM56, GE90 and GP7200 commercial engines that are manufactured by General Electric and Snecma.

Safety: a duty

Our goal is to communicate a real health & safety culture:


  1.     Awareness campaign for managers regarding respect of safety regulations

  2.     Employees are regularly reminded to respect safety regulations (individual safety equipments must be worn, risk areas…)

  3.     Reinforced communications: awareness campaign organized by the “Hand Clinic” (external medical organization)

  4.     Ergonomics trainings and evaluations at work station

  5.     Best practices / exchanges with Snecma & General Electric
